Understanding Modern Threats

Today’s threats range from malware and phishing attacks to more sophisticated exploits targeting software vulnerabilities. Here are some prevalent types of threats:

  • Malware: Malicious software that can damage or disrupt systems.
  • Phishing: Fraudulent attempts to acquire sensitive information by masquerading as a trustworthy entity.
  • Zero-day Exploits: Attacks that occur before developers have a chance to fix vulnerabilities.
  • Ransomware: A type of malware that locks users out of their systems until a ransom is paid.

Understanding these threats is crucial for developing resilient software that can withstand attacks and protect user data effectively.

Best Practices for Secure Software Development

As the landscape of digital security evolves, here are some best practices that developers should adopt:

  • Implement Security by Design: Integrate security measures from the outset rather than as an afterthought.
  • Conduct Regular Security Audits: Frequent assessments can help identify and rectify vulnerabilities.
  • Keep Software Updated: Regular updates patch known vulnerabilities and improve overall security.
  • Educate Users: Providing users with knowledge about safe practices can significantly enhance security.

By prioritizing these practices, developers can create more secure applications that protect users from emerging threats.

The Significance of Containerization in Software Security

One innovative approach that has gained traction in the realm of software development is containerization. This method encapsulates software applications within containers, creating isolated environments that enhance security and efficiency.

Why Containerization Matters Now

Containerization has become increasingly relevant in the context of cloud computing and microservices architecture. Here’s why:

  • Enhanced Isolation: Containers keep applications and their dependencies separate, reducing the risk of vulnerabilities affecting the entire system.
  • Portability: Applications can be easily moved across environments, which is essential for modern development practices.
  • Scalability: Containers can be quickly scaled up or down as needed, making them ideal for fluctuating workloads.

This approach not only bolsters security but also enhances operational efficiency and flexibility for developers.
